Combining nonthermal technologies to control foodborne microorganisms.

Alexander I V Ross1, Mansel W Griffiths, Gauri S Mittal

  • 1Department of Food Science, University of Guelph, Ontario, Canada N1G 2W1.

Summary

Combining nonthermal food preservation techniques, like high hydrostatic pressure (HHP) and pulsed electric fields (PEFs), enhances microbial inactivation. This allows for lower treatment intensities, improving food safety and quality.
